Nurse Jobs in Japan: Requirements & Support

Securing a position as a nurse in Japan can be a exciting opportunity, but it necessitates careful preparation and adherence to specific requirements. Generally, international applicants must possess a valid registered nursing credential from their place of origin, which will need to be verified for equivalency by the Japanese Nursing Association. In addition, proficiency in the Japanese language is almost invariably needed, although some healthcare centers may provide limited positions for English-speaking nurses.

  • Substantiated expertise in nursing procedures is vital.
  • Completing the Japanese Credentialing Assessment is often required.
  • Assistance initiatives are available to help foreign nurses through the application.
